Responsibilities:
The Quality Improvement Manager is responsible for administering
and managing the facilitys quality improvement programs. Incumbent
will be overseeing and responsible for areas including, but not
inclusive to:Administering and managing the facilitys quality
improvement programs.Collects and summarizes performance data,
identifies opportunities for improvement, and presents findings as
needed.Actively participates on, or facilitates committees such as:
Quality Improvement, Utilization Management, Patient Safety, and
Risk Management.Responsible for determining proactive methodologies
to continue a culture of patient safety and risk reduction within
the organization.Knowledge of CMS DMHC, CA Department of Health &
Safety, CA Department of Insurance, NCQA standards, including HEDIS
criteria.Effectively manage financial resources within the area(s)
of responsibility including labor management, productivity,
supplies, and other resources.
